Abstract
In the title sulfonate derivative,C 24H 26O 9S 3, all atoms apart from those of one of the 4-methyl-benzene-sulfonate residues lie approximately in a disc; the dihedral angles between the approximately orthogonal benzene ring and those in the plane are 74.53 (9) and 67.79 (11)°. In the crystal, molecules are consolidated into the three-dimensional architecture by C - H⋯O interactions. One of the 4-methyl-benzene-sulfonate residues is disordered over two almost parallel positions; the major component refined to a site-occupancy factor of 0.918 (2).
